网络拓扑优化的方法与实践

风吹麦浪 2019-08-25 ⋅ 19 阅读

在互联网时代,网络拓扑优化是构建高效、可靠网络基础架构的关键。不仅可以提高数据传输速度和可靠性,还可以合理分配网络资源,提升用户体验。本文将介绍几种常见的网络拓扑优化方法,并分享一些实践经验。

1. 负载均衡

负载均衡是一种常见的网络拓扑优化方法,通过分配网络流量到多个服务器上,实现资源的最优利用。常见的负载均衡算法有轮询、加权轮询、最小连接数等。例如,可以使用软硬件负载均衡器,根据网络流量和服务器负载情况,智能地将请求分发到最佳服务器上。

2. 冗余路径

冗余路径是指网络中存在多条流量传输路径。通过设置冗余路径,可以提高网络的容错性和可靠性。在实践中,可以使用路由协议实现冗余路径的选择和管理。例如,使用动态路由协议BGP(边界网关协议)可以实现冗余路径的选择和故障切换。

3. 分段网络

为了提高网络性能,可以将大型网络划分为多个分段网络。每个分段网络内部有自己的路由器和交换机,可以独立管理和优化。这样可以避免单一网络过大而导致的性能问题。同时,分段网络还可以加强网络安全,限制不同分段网络之间的访问。

4. 智能边缘网络

随着物联网和边缘计算的兴起,智能边缘网络在网络拓扑优化中扮演着越来越重要的角色。智能边缘网络通过将数据处理和存储推向网络边缘,实现更低的延迟和更高的可靠性。在实践中,可以使用边缘计算技术和边缘设备来构建智能边缘网络。

5. 优化网络设备配置

在网络拓扑优化中,合理配置网络设备也是至关重要的。包括交换机、路由器、防火墙等设备的配置参数,可以根据网络流量、需求和性能指标进行调整。例如,可以优化IP地址分配、MTU大小、缓冲区大小等配置项,提高网络传输性能和吞吐量。

实践经验

在实践中,网络拓扑优化需要综合考虑网络规模、负载情况、业务需求等因素。以下是一些建议的实践经验:

  1. 监控网络性能:定期监控网络性能指标,包括延迟、带宽利用率、丢包率等。通过监控数据分析,及时优化网络拓扑。

  2. 定期评估网络需求:随着业务的发展,网络需求也会不断变化。定期评估网络需求,是否需要增加带宽、调整网络拓扑等。

  3. 故障切换测试:定期进行故障切换测试,验证冗余路径的可用性和可靠性。确保在主路径发生故障时,其他路径可以正常传输数据。

  4. 与供应商合作:合作伙伴和供应商可能具有丰富的网络拓扑优化经验。与他们合作,可以获取更多的建议和方案。

总结起来,网络拓扑优化是构建高效、可靠网络基础架构的关键。通过负载均衡、冗余路径、分段网络、智能边缘网络和优化设备配置等方法与实践,可以提高网络性能、可靠性和安全性。在实践中,需要不断监控网络性能,评估网络需求,进行故障切换测试,并与供应商合作,共同优化网络拓扑。


全部评论: 0

    我有话说: